The Gertrudes repertoire—and family—continues to grow. Just to Please You, due to be released August 18 (Outside Music Canada/Wolfe Island Records), contains contributions from band members Arden Rogalsky (drums), George Tilson (vocals), August Erb (electric guitar), as well as next generation Gertrudes, including Arden (drums), George (vocals), August (electric guitar) and Astrid (vocals) — Matt, Greg, and Jason’s kids. The ten-song offering follows The Gertrudes' 2021 “pandemic-soaked” full-length, Emergency to Emergency.

With Neptune’s Machine producer Jason Mercer (ani di franco, Ron Sexsmith) at the helm, Just to Please You promises a divergence from The Gertrudes' sonic standard, blending “...the band’s classic indie-folk-rock-experimental vibe into a soundscape that’s more of a refined martini than craft beer, more organic farm than community garden.”

Drawing on influences like Wilco and The National, the ten songs traverse tales of community trauma, social justice and prison escapes, accented by deeper reflections on isolation, togetherness and love. As with previous albums, Just to Please You is a tribute to the multigenerational folkestra's cherished Skeleton Park neighbourhood in downtown Kingston, where most bandmates reside, and within which The Gertrudes have become an inclusive cultural institution. With the new album, “The Gertrudes knit together a sound like an old-time salon party travelling through deep space,” explained a news release from the band.

Just to Please You will be released on August 18, 2023 on all streaming platforms, including Bandcamp. The first single from the album, "The Last Rehearsal," is out today, along with a music video by Kingston filmmaker, Jay Middaugh (Happy Kid Productions). View the video here: web link

The album cover artwork for Just to Please You was created by Julie Davidson Smith. Posted: May 17, 2023 Originally Published: May 18, 2023
